Product Description

Size: 56

Clinical research has shown that the ingredients in pmsharmony, including bioresponse dim, calcium, magnesium, vitamin d and chasteberry extract help decrease many of the symptoms associated with pms and help balance hormones. Pmsharmony contains chasteberry extract, standardized for 0.5% agnusides. Pmsharmony also contains calcium and magnesium, and botanical ingredients, including asparagus racemosus extract, that may provide relief from pms symptoms. Whole, unextracted chasteberry, dong quai and black cohosh root are included and provide all the natural plant co-factors that nature created.

5.0 out of 5 stars Must-have product for regulating my periods!, September 5, 2011

I love this stuff. About a year ago, noticed my periods had become wildly irregular; I'd never been clockwork-regular, usually it would be anywhere from 28 to 35 days... but now it was going to 40+ days. I looked into available natural remedies to regulate periods/hormones and found good, consistent feedback on PMSHarmony on other websites, so I decided to give it a try.

One jar contains a 2-week supply, and exact directions aren't included, so I went through some trial and error before I figured out the best way to take it. At first, I took it for one week before the estimated start date of my period, and then for one week during my period. This didn't work at all, I think for two reasons: 1.) I was so irregular that I couldn't estimate my start date with any accuracy, and 2.) Taking the product during my period didn't make any sense, since it's a PMS product (pretty obvious in retrospect, but oh well).

When I started taking it two weeks AFTER the start date of my last period (which was a lot easier to track), my next period began the day after my last serving! And it's stayed that way ever since, as long as I'm taking it every month. Last month, I belatedly noticed that PMSHarmony was no longer available through Subscribe & Save so I substituted Nature's Way Dim-Plus Capsules, 60-Count instead. Both products have the same amount of DIM (100 mg per serving), so I thought it was worth a try-- it didn't work at all. My period came 41 days after the last one... so that was a good reminder to stick with what works for me.

I really like that I don't have to take it every day, but just for those two weeks before my period. I use an online period tracker/calculator and as soon as my period starts, I count two weeks out and fill in the start date for my next round of PMSHarmony. I consider the cost (usually around $11.00 including shipping) to be an excellent value since it regulates my period so perfectly, AND it minimizes my PMS moodiness, breast tenderness, and breakouts. I've never suffered from menstrual cramps or bloating so I can't speak to how it works for those symptoms, but I'd still recommend trying it, unless of course you're allergic to any of the ingredients.
